Steel Hawg is a "El Loco" coaster from S&S.  About the easiest way to describe this coaster is to call it a wild mouse coaster on crack. The first drop is beyond vertical.  It turns you upside down and leaves you there.  The finale is a downward inline twist before hitting a high banked turn before a ricked pop of airtime as you hit the brakes.  These are great rides for parks with space issues like Indiana Beach.
